Description Miguel Chavez Gamboa 2008-02-23 06:30:59 UTC
Version:            (using KDE 4.0.1)
Installed from:    Unlisted Binary Package
OS:                Linux

Enabling Blur effect causes some strange lines drawn in menu items when the cursor is over it and around a widget like a line edit. This happens about 70% of the time, the other 30% the widgets are drawn correctly.

Disabling blur make this strange behavior disappear.

kde 4.0.1 on archlinux. Nvidia 7150 (nvidia driver).X Server 1.4.0.90.

Comment 3 Mike 2008-06-15 21:23:22 UTC
I think that I am also seeing a similar problem, each time something is repainted there is a ~3px border around what actually needs to be repainted.  You can see this effect with the show paint plugin.  This border is not painted properly and instead the immediatly window below is painted.  Repainting the window by moving it slightly paints it back properly.
Comment 4 Georg Wittenburg 2008-06-20 19:28:56 UTC
The problem seems to be gone with KDE 4.0.82 and nvidia 173.14.09. However, as it wasn't straighforward to reproduce before, I'd give it some more time before closing this bug.
Comment 5 Georg Wittenburg 2008-06-20 20:38:21 UTC
The problem is almost gone. The only way to reproduce it is by zooming out with the Plasma icon in the top right corner. This draws a miscolored border around the affected region. I doesn't happen if the blur plugin is disabled.
Comment 6 lucas 2008-06-21 05:17:35 UTC
Happens all the time with me with nVidia drivers 173, but not at all with drivers 169. It's not a solid color for me but rather an offset version of the screen. To reproduce just slide desktops with desktop grid then move the mouse over windows.

Comment 16 Shayne Johnson 2009-05-24 02:21:07 UTC
I'm having the same issues as described above.

This is a screenshot (link below) of what happens when I activate KdeSudo. the same problem occurs in Gwenview when viewing images full-screen. I am also experiencing the strange glowy borders around krunner and plasma tooltips, and the entire desktop shifting up by one pixel when blur is enabled. With blur off, none of these issues exist.

I have tried every NVidia driver there is to no avail, and every version of KDE from 4.0.0 to 4.2.85, from Qt 4.3 to 4.5.1 (all i've tested), experiences the same issues. I'm currently running KDE 4.2.85 with Qt 4.5.1 and the 185.18.10 NVidia driver.

Comment 21 Martin Flöser 2010-03-31 15:27:22 UTC
As there will be a new blur effect in KDE SC 4.5 it does not make sense to keep this report open. If the new blur effect should show the same issue, it is a new bug unrelated to this one.
